When you own any type of property there are a few things you want out of it: getting top dollar, selling it quickly, and working with a good buyer. When you are selling a luxury residential property, selling your home can be a little bit more difficult. One of the biggest obstacles that a lot of luxury residential home owners run into when selling their home is that it sits on the market for a little bit longer than others. To help your luxury property sell faster, there are a few different tips for you to keep in mind. 

1. You Can't List It Too High

While the market may be in a great place right now and sellers have never had this much say when selling their home, you don't want to list it too high. If you list your house at a price point that is unreasonable then you aren't going to get as many people who are interested in it, and your house is going to sit on the market for a lot longer.

Something to consider when you are listing your house is that you want to pick a number that ends in 99 so that your property comes up when people are searching for different prices on the MLS. For instance, if you list your house at an even 900k and someone filters their online search to under 900k, your property won't show up. However, if you list it at 899k, then it will show up which will hopefully generate more interest in your home. 

2. Have a Broker's Open

A broker's open is essentially an open house that's just for brokers. This is an opportunity for brokers to view the house before it hits the real estate market and gives them and their clients a heads up regarding your property. While a broker's open isn't something that's useful for typical properties, when you're dealing with a luxury home listing, you want to get on the radar of some elite buyers and this is a great way to do it. To host a successful broker's open, consider having it catered and make sure that you get the invite out to broker's ahead of time so they can be there. 

3. Work With a Luxury Real Estate Agent

When you work with a professional, you are more likely to get professional results. While all realtors have the same training upfront, not all of them have the same experience. When you are looking for a real estate agent, look for one that has a ton of experience with luxury properties like yours because then they'll know how to price it, how to sell it, and how to market it.
